Course Details
• Competitive Analysis Overview: Understanding the basics of competitive analysis, its importance, and the process involved. • Market Research: Techniques for gathering information about competitors, including market analysis and SWOT analysis. • Product Analysis: Examining competitors' products, features, and benefits to determine strengths and weaknesses. • Pricing Analysis: Comparing competitors' pricing strategies, discounts, and promotions to determine market trends. • Distribution Analysis: Analyzing competitors' sales channels, distribution networks, and geographic reach. • Promotion Analysis: Evaluating competitors' advertising, marketing, and branding efforts to identify best practices. • Customer Analysis: Understanding competitors' target customers, buying behavior, and customer satisfaction. • Competitive Strategy: Developing strategies to differentiate from competitors, including positioning, messaging, and value proposition. • Monitoring and Tracking: Techniques for monitoring competitors' activities, updates, and changes in the market. • Case Studies: Real-world examples of successful competitive analysis in the publishing industry.
